How to Save Money When Moving

Tips from a Reliable Moving & Storage Company for Lowering Your Expenses during a Move

If you have had to move before, then you probably know how overwhelming, expensive, and tiresome it can be. You have to take some time off from work to plan and organize everything, get packing supplies, call a moving & storage company, pack all of your belongings, and finally, move and start over.

 

All that can be a serious burden on your budget. That is why we have decided to help you with a  few ideas for making your relocation as cost-efficient as possible.

 

  1. The first thing you should do is get some packing materials. For example, cardboard boxes are  excellent for transporting all sorts of household items, even the most fragile china. You can even find some free cardboard boxes by asking your local stores if they have some to spare. Another way to get some cheap packing materials is by asking a friend or a neighbor who has moved recently, for boxes and and other moving supplies they don’t need anymore.

  1. Secondly, you will have to pack your household items and personal belongings. Naturally, you can leave that chore to a professional moving company, but since you want to save some money, you may need to do it on your own. If you don’t think you can handle all the work by yourself, call a neighbor or friend a to lend you a hand.

  1. Make sure you use everything you can to your advantage while packing. Don’t waste money on packing materials when you can use  travelling bags and suitcases? You can use blankets and towels to wrap fragile and breakable items such as glassware and fine china. This will help you save space too.

  1. If there are some things that you don’t need anymore or simply don’t want to move, you can always put on a yard sale to make some extra cash.
